1 Prepare a calibration solution of 1.00 M NaCl, 58.44 g/l. Let
the solution stand until it is at room temperature. This is
important for exact measurements.
2 Fill the flow cell completely with the calibration solution by
pumping at least 15 ml through the cell with a syringe.
3 Stop the flow and wait 15 minutes until the temperature is
constant in the range 20–30 °C.
4 Read the conductivity value displayed and compare it with the
theoretical value from the graph below at the temperature of
the calibration solution. If the displayed value and the
theoretical value correspond, no further action is required.
If the values differ, proceed with actions 5-8
